PRICE, PRICE, PRICE
The old adage of Location, Location, Location still holds true but PRICE is KING!!!!! Price can overcome location, location can not overcome price. Price can overcome condition, condition can not overcome price. Pricing your home to sell is the most important issue with selling a home in a buyer's market. Supply vs Demand says that as inventory grows, prices must fall. Buyers have more choices and the choices that they will make will depend on the price. Buyers will rarely offer full asking price on an "overpriced" home. Properly priced homes will often recieve multiple offers.
To price a home properly, sellers need to see recent sales similar to their home and sellers need to know what the competition looks like. A sellable home needs to be priced in the bottom 1/3 of the competition, preferably the lowest price. To enhance the sellability, the home needs to be in the top 1/3 in condition. BOTTOM 1/3 PRICE, TOP 1/3 CONDITION.
